Know Your Target Audience
Understanding your target audience is the first step in any successful marketing strategy. Who are your customers? What do they like? What are their buying habits?
To answer these questions, consider conducting surveys or focus groups. This will give you valuable insights into your customers' preferences.
Once you have a clear picture of your audience, tailor your marketing messages to resonate with them. For example, if your target audience is health-conscious individuals, highlight the nutritional benefits of your food product.
Create a Strong Brand Identity
A strong brand identity helps your product stand out. It includes your logo, packaging, and overall messaging.
Invest time in creating a memorable logo that reflects your brand's values. Your packaging should also be eye-catching and informative. Use colors and designs that appeal to your target audience.
For instance, if you are selling organic snacks, use earthy tones and eco-friendly materials. This not only attracts customers but also communicates your commitment to sustainability.
Utilize Social Media Marketing
Social media is a powerful tool for promoting your food product. Plat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and TikTok allow you to reach a wide audience.
Start by creating engaging content that showcases your product. Use high-quality images and videos to capture attention. Share recipes, behind-the-scenes looks, and customer testimonials.
Engagement is key. Respond to comments and messages promptly. Consider running contests or giveaways to encourage interaction. This not only builds a community around your brand but also increases visibility.

Leverage Influencer Marketing
Influencer marketing can significantly boost your product's visibility. Collaborate with influencers who align with your brand values.
Choose influencers who have a genuine connection with their audience. They can create authentic content that showcases your product in a relatable way.
For example, if you sell vegan snacks, partner with a vegan lifestyle influencer. Their endorsement can introduce your product to a new audience and build trust.
Optimize Your Website for Sales
Your website is often the first point of contact for potential customers. Ensure it is user-friendly and optimized for sales.
Start with a clean design that highlights your products. Use high-quality images and clear descriptions. Make the purchasing process as simple as possible.
Consider adding customer reviews and testimonials to build credibility. A well-optimized website can significantly increase your conversion rates.
Email Marketing Campaigns
Email marketing is a cost-effective way to reach your customers directly. Build an email list by offering incentives, such as discounts or exclusive content.
Send regular newsletters that include product updates, promotions, and valuable content. Personalize your emails to make them more engaging.
For instance, segment your audience based on their preferences. This allows you to send targeted messages that resonate with each group.
Attend Food Trade Shows and Events
Participating in food trade shows and events can provide excellent exposure for your product. These events allow you to connect with potential customers and industry professionals.
Prepare samples of your product to give away. This not only attracts attention but also allows customers to experience your product firsthand.
Networking at these events can lead to valuable partnerships and collaborations.
Offer Promotions and Discounts
Promotions and discounts can entice customers to try your product. Consider offering limited-time discounts or bundle deals.
For example, if you sell sauces, offer a discount when customers buy multiple flavors. This encourages customers to try more of your products.
Promotions can also create a sense of urgency, prompting customers to make a purchase sooner rather than later.
Focus on Customer Service
Excellent customer service can set you apart from competitors. Ensure your team is trained to handle inquiries and complaints effectively.
Respond to customer feedback, whether positive or negative. This shows that you value their opinions and are committed to improving your product.
Consider implementing a loyalty program to reward repeat customers. This not only encourages them to return but also fosters brand loyalty.
Collaborate with Local Businesses
Partnering with local businesses can expand your reach. Consider collaborating with cafes, restaurants, or grocery stores to feature your product.
This not only increases visibility but also builds community support.
For example, if you sell artisanal bread, partner with a local coffee shop to offer your bread as part of their menu. This creates a win-win situation for both businesses.
Monitor Your Marketing Efforts
Finally, it is essential to monitor the effectiveness of your marketing strategies. Use analytics tools to track your website traffic, social media engagement, and sales data.
This information can help you identify what works and what needs improvement.
Regularly review your marketing efforts and adjust your strategies accordingly. This will ensure you stay relevant and continue to grow your sales.
